**Build provenance — Ladleworks recipe scaler.** New team members: every release of the Ladleworks scaling calculator is built by the Hobnail pipeline, which signs artifacts and records the source revision, builder image, and dependency lockfile digest. Nothing ships from laptops. When investigating a customer-reported scaling bug, always confirm which exact build they're running before reproducing, since rounding behaviour changed between release trains. Each verified artifact embeds its provenance token, shown below.

pipeline stamp: htk21_86b657ac0aa916a9af17f

**Onboarding note: Wavecrest audio previews**

The waveform preview service renders peaks server-side and caches them for 24 hours. Uploads never leave the Fernhollow VPC; only derived peak data reaches the CDN. For your review: the renderer runs unprivileged, and all fetches are signed. It authenticates to the media store with a secret defined in its .env on the next line.

secret setting of bajeg-yahog: LEDGER_TOKEN20=f833f3e2e6625ec0dee3

Subject: Quick heads-up on the Brindlecote deal

Hi all,

Wanted to loop in the branch managers early: we're in exploratory talks to acquire Brindlecote Logistics. Nothing is signed, and diligence only kicked off last week, so please keep this within this group. If it goes ahead, it would roughly double our coverage in the Harrowdale corridor and bring about forty staff over. No changes to branch operations for now — business as usual. Questions to me directly, not by branch channels. The confidential plan summary sits just below this line.

internal memo for kawip-hadug: Headcount on the Wenwyn team goes from 7 to 140 by the end of January. Gross margin on Wenwyn came in at 20 percent against a plan of 15 percent.